As you explore her discography, it’s clear that Twain’s influence lies in her ability to bridge two worlds. She doesn’t just incorporate pop into country; she elevates and redefines both genres through her innovative approach. Her breakthrough album, *Come On Over*, exemplifies this genre blending, featuring tracks that are as likely to top pop charts as they are country charts. This crossover appeal helps you understand how she’s reshaped the landscape of radio programming—no longer confined to niche country stations, her music dominates mainstream airwaves, making her a household name across genres.
